summaryrefslogtreecommitdiffstats
path: root/.config/dovecot
diff options
context:
space:
mode:
authorAmin Bandali <bandali@gnu.org>2023-10-26 21:55:02 -0400
committerAmin Bandali <bandali@gnu.org>2023-10-26 21:55:02 -0400
commit946d377019a733c7abc04e96091a9b8ed30db9db (patch)
treed8065db1c4675f516e818c7a3d93061035d52059 /.config/dovecot
parentffe2df238c5c7ca7093d89324e9078ccaac01984 (diff)
downloadconfigs-946d377019a733c7abc04e96091a9b8ed30db9db.tar.gz
configs-946d377019a733c7abc04e96091a9b8ed30db9db.tar.xz
configs-946d377019a733c7abc04e96091a9b8ed30db9db.zip
Various updates from darya
Diffstat (limited to '')
-rw-r--r--.config/dovecot/canonical.sieve7
1 files changed, 6 insertions, 1 deletions
diff --git a/.config/dovecot/canonical.sieve b/.config/dovecot/canonical.sieve
index 5b32d11..3802ffb 100644
--- a/.config/dovecot/canonical.sieve
+++ b/.config/dovecot/canonical.sieve
@@ -11,7 +11,7 @@ if address :is "from" "noreply+discourse@canonical.com" {
stop;
}
-if address :is :domain "from" ["discourse.ubuntu.com", "forum.snapcraft.io"] {
+if address :is :domain "from" ["discourse.ubuntu.com", "forum.snapcraft.io", "discourse.charmhub.io"] {
fileinto :create "discourse";
stop;
}
@@ -51,6 +51,11 @@ if address :is "from" "notifications@github.com" {
stop;
}
+if header :regex "list-id" "<.+.xt.local>" {
+ keep;
+ stop;
+}
+
if allof (header :regex "list-id" "<([a-z_0-9-]+)[.@]",
not address :regex :localpart "from" "^(no)?reply")
{